William Upski Wimsatt is a social entrepreneur, philanthropic
advisor, public speaker, journalist, and political organizer,
Wimsatt serves as the Executive Director of Movement 2017 a
platform to support progressive donors to find and fund the best
local and national networks combining grassroots issue organizing
and voting. He is also President of the Gamechanger family of
organizations which supports innovation, collaboration, and new
leaders to upgrade social movements for the 21st Century.
Wimsatt has written for Vibe, Chicago Tribune, The Washington Post,
The Nation, and published six books with 100,000+ copies in print
including No More Prisons, Bomb the Suburbs, and its follow up
companion- Please Don't Bomb the Suburbs- A Midterm Report on My
Generation, and the Future of our Super Movement.
He is also the editor and publisher of three anthologies- Another
World is Possible- Conversations in a Time of Terror; Future 500-
Youth Organizing and Activism in United States; and How to Get
Stupid White Men Out of Office- the anti-politics, un-boring guide
to power, with Adrienne Maree Brown.
